Lean Turkey Burger with Crispy Sweet Potato Wedges
Savor the hearty flavors of a lean turkey burger paired with oven-roasted, crispy sweet potato wedges. This meal is elevated with a touch of olive oil and fresh tomato and red onion toppings, delivering a satisfying balance of lean protein, complex carbohydrates, and vibrant, natural flavors in every bite.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z Lean Ground Turkey
1 medium Sweet Potato
1 tsp Olive Oil
2 servings Tomato
2 servings Red Onion
Seasonings (Salt, Pepper, Garlic Powder)
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 425°F.
Prepare the sweet potato by washing it thoroughly, then slice into wedges. Toss the wedges with olive oil and season with sal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
Arrange the sweet potato wedges on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Roast for 20-25 minutes until they are crisp on the outside and tender inside, flipping halfway through.
While the wedges roast, form the lean ground turkey into a patty. Season both sides generously with sal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
Cook the turkey patty in a preheated non-stick skillet over medium heat for about 4-5 minutes per side, or until fully cooked through and the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
Assemble the turkey burger by placing the cooked patty on a plate and topping it with fresh tomato slices and red onion rings. Serve alongside the crispy sweet potato wedges.
